ABSOLUT Fringe Festival launches today!

Words: Caroline Foran
Though it feels like just yesterday that 2011's Brave New World ABSOLUT Fringe Festival wrapped up, this year's eclectic mix of shows is already upon us. What makes this year's festival even more special than the ones that have gone before is that in 2012, the festival turns 18, giving us even more reason to celebrate. Today marks the much anticipated launch of the 2012 ABSOLUT Fringe Festival with an exciting and poignant theme - 'Occupy your Imagination'. Fronted by the Rubberbandits, this year's launch takes place at the Button Factory this evening and we'll be there along with our eTV crew to chat to festival director Róise Goan about what we can expect from the 16 day festival programme, what we should see without fail and what sets this festival apart from the rest. We'll also find out what you, the public, are most excited for this year.

Before we bring you the full festival breakdown - which includes 90 shows of theatre, comedy, music, circus and the more unusual fare - let's take a look at some of the highlights, chosen by the festival organisers.
THEATRE
ELEVATOR | THISISPOPBABY
Following their smash hit musical at the Abbey Theatre, producing powerhouse THISISPOPBABY (Alice in Funderland, Trade, The Year of Magical Wanking) present a fractured parable of a world where everything is available but nothing ever satisfies.
SINGLEHOOD | Una McKevitt
Award-winning theatre maker Una McKevitt explores what it’s like to be a ‘singleton’ in a world that you are often shunned for not being in a conventional relationship or marriage - Singlehood is an explosive look into the highs and lows of being single. And it's all true.
HUNGRY TENDER | THEATREclub
'Spirit of the Fringe Award 2010’ winners THEATREclub return with a major new work. A show for anyone who has ever gotten up in the middle of the night to make and devour a mountain of toast. It’s a comeback concert by Shane Byrne about FOOD and ELVIS PRESLEY: The King.
WHITE RABBIT RED RABBIT | Nassim Soleimanpour
This play is taking festivals the world over by storm. The play will see some of the biggest names in Irish Theatre take a leap of faith performing from a script they have never seen before. Creator Nassim Soleimanpour is forbidden to travel from his home country of Iran so he turns his isolation into advantage with a play that requires no director, no set and a different actor for every performance.
SOLPADEINE IS MY BOYFRIEND | With an ‘F’ Productions
Steffanie Priessner’s self-deprecating humour and unflinching honesty are quickly becoming a trademark worth paying for. The play is about change – thoses we can’t control, can’t come back from, like growing up, emigrating and that moment you realise: you’re not who you thought you were going to be.
SPARKPLUG | Little John Nee
This treasure of a show is one for anyone who’s felt like they haven’t belonged, and who believes in magic. Sparkplug Callaghan is a songster, showman and storymaker who returns to Tullyglen in Co. Donegal. He’s got the blues bad: everyday there’s another funeral, Joe Duffy’s on the radio and the banks are putting people on the side of the road…but across the meadow he sees a vision...his boat has come in.
MUSIC
RUBBERBANDITS
The phenomenon that is Rubberbandits come home after taking Edinburgh by storm for their first ever outdoor concert in Dublin city centre. This outrageous live show combining music sketches and on-stage insanity is a definite sell-out - so book your ticket as soon as possible.
EFTERKLANG
Kicking off their world tour and brand new album release, Paramida, music doesn’t come much cooler than the majestic sounds of Efterklang. For one night only Danish alt-pop band will take to the stage on Meeting House Square accompanied by the Major Lift Orchestra. Gigs this special are few and far between so prepare yourself for a music experience like no other.
FLÅTPÄCK | Ulysses Opera Theatre
FLÅTPÄCK is an opera in five rooms about living with furniture. Eight singers and instrumentalists present an ‘awesome’ (The Times London) and ‘simply beautiful’ (Opernwelt, Berlin) mixture of opera, humour and carpentry, with music composed by Tom Lane and a libretto made of IKEA product titles. We present you, the audience, with all of the pieces you need — you’ll enjoy putting it together.
KORMAC’S BIG BAND
Festival favourites all over Ireland, this is Kormac's only date in Dublin this year - Get ready as he and his 11 piece band invade Meeting House Square and create musical mayhem. Described by BBC Radio 1’s Annie Mac as “the most bizarre set-up I've ever seen - but it really works,”. Kormac’s Big Band have become a global sensation with tours all over Europe and Australia.
DANCE
DOGS | Emma Martin
Irish choreographer, Emma martin, premieres a brand new dance piece after her breakout hit at ABSOLUT Fringe 2010 with Listowel Syndrome, which still has people talking. This new work is hotly anticipated.
STRAIGHT TO DVD | Ponydance
The fantastic Ponydance return to ABSOLUT fringe with more verve than before after their pervious Fringe hit shows (Where did it all go right? 2009, Anybody Waitin’ 2010). These Fringe favourites hoof their way through words and dance, bringing you Saturday night television at its worst, ad breaks and all. Don’t miss this show!
DANCE DOUBLE BILL – EMPTY ECHO & SOFTER SWELLS | Aoife McAtamney
Two new dance works from the extremely talented Aoife McAtamney – one solo work and one with her excellent conspirators of Dish Dance.
OUTDOOR / UNUSUAL / SPECTACLE
BRIEFS
Australia’s award winning mischief-makers in a circus-infused variety show for the not-so-faint-hearted. Sold out at every festival they’ve played across the world. There’s a good reason why - the best night out you’ll have this year.
THE PLAYGROUND
The Playground programme is all about immersing yourself, getting involved and being an active participant. The festival has brought you some of the best participatory experiences from around the world to Dublin, so dress warm, wear comfortable shoes and don’t be shy! This programme features 7 different amazing experiences including:
MACNAS | Rumpus & The Cockroach And The Inventor
After their astounding successes in 2010 and 2011, Macnas return to the festival with two very special shows Rumpus and The Cockroach And The Inventor - Tickets are free but limited so book early.
WORD RIVER | Fergal McCarthy
Artist Fergal McCarthy returns with a new art installation in 2012, his final collaboration with ABSOLUT Fringe in a triptych which sees him subtly provoking this city of famous literature and speaking our language.
FARM | WillFredd Theatre
Spirit of the Fringe 2011 winners WillFredd Theatre have teamed up with farmers, beekeepers, allotment owners and city dwellers to interrupt the city centre with FARM, a space where the Rural and the Urban unite and bloom. This new work from the excellent WillFredd Theatre is unbearably exciting. Put your wellies on and get down to the Farm.
CIRCUS
THIS IS WHAT WE DO FOR A LIVING | Tumble Circus
Comedy circus with a theatrical narrative of how a Dublin boy and a Swedish girl met on Grafton Street in the 90’s and fell in and out of love. Featuring flying hula hoops, slapstick acrobatics, stunning aerial rope and daring double trapeze, it has wowed audiences of all ages the world over. 2012 winner Best Circus andPhysical Theatre Show Adelaide Fringe.
SELL OUT TOUR | Lords of Strut
Cork’s finest make their ABSOLUT Fringe debut with a non-stop rollercoaster of comedy, circus tricks and bucketloads of charm
CONSTELLATIONS | PaperDolls
They came out of nowhere last year with their eponymous debut and now PaperDolls bring us on a shamanic trip seeking truth and necessity in a suspended territory of uninhibited youth, energy, physical ability and ropes. Another amazing ‘must see’ event at ABSOLUT Fringe.
CAUGHT | Fidget Feet Aerial Dance Theatre
Fidget Feet are a pint-sized Cirque du Soleil originating from Donegal, returning to ABSOLUT Fringe after 2010’s sensual Hang On. This sexy, dark and dangerous visual feast is a retelling of a fairytale, but this time it's strictly for grown-ups
COMEDY
DEAD CAT BOUNCE….CLOWNS
International comedy supergroup Dead Cat Bounce make their first appearance at ABSOLUT Fringe with a brand new comedy play, Clowns. Dead Cat Bounce have performed to packed houses and critical acclaim at all the major international comedy festivals from Edinburgh to Melbourne to Montreal. A real treat at this year’s festival.
THE REVOLUTION WILL BE TELEVISED, ReTWEETED & AVAILABLE ON 4OD | Abie Philban Bowman
Contemporary Irish political and social satire at its very best – Abie Philban Bowban’s latest Fringe production surfaces on the coat-tails of Jesus: The Guantanamo Years, Pope Benedict: Bond Villain and Stand-Up Against The Bankers. His new show is a revolutionary comedy for ABSOLUT Fringe 2012.
